On the Impact of Thermal Gradients Across Fluxgate Sensors on In Situ Magnetic Field Measurements
Abstract Fluxgate magnetometers are an important tool for measuring space plasmas. In situ magnetic field investigations often involve measuring small perturbations of a large background field, so robust instrument calibration is critical to accurately resolving geophysical signals.

Disappearance of the Polar Cap Ionosphere During Geomagnetic Storm on 11 May 2019
Abstract Multi‐instrument data from Jang Bogo Station (JBS) in Antarctica were utilized to study ionospheric responses to the 11 May 2019 moderate geomagnetic storm. These include Vertical Incident Pulsed Ionospheric Radar (VIPIR)/Dynasonde, Fabry‐Perot Interferometer (FPI), GPS vertical total electron content (vTEC), and magnetometer.
